HR fills one form. The checklist, the welcome, the announcement, and the paperwork all happen on their own.

Onboarding fails in the gap between offer accepted and day one, and it fails the same way every time, somebody forgets a step. This recipe turns that whole stretch into one submission. HR enters the new hire once; their task card is created, their welcome email goes out with a document-upload link, and the team is told who's starting and when. When the documents come back, a second workflow matches them to the right record and marks them received. The tracker sheet always shows exactly where each hire stands.

How it works

Step by step, once it is running.

  1. 01
    HR Adds the New Hire

    One New Hire Intake submission captures the person, their personal email, role, department, manager, start date, and work location, and kicks the whole thing off. That's the only manual step in the entire recipe.

  2. 02
    Their Onboarding Tasks Are Created

    The workflow creates an onboarding-tasks card in Trello carrying your standard checklist and any mandatory training, tagged with their role, department, start date, and manager. You define that checklist once at install and every hire after gets it identically. Swap Trello for Notion, Asana, or Monday.com.

  3. 03
    They Get a Warm Welcome

    A branded Welcome & Documents email goes to the new hire with a link to upload everything HR needs before day one. It arrives while they're still excited about the offer, which is precisely when people actually do their paperwork.

  4. 04
    The Team Is Notified

    A Slack message announces the new hire and their start date, so nobody is surprised by an unfamiliar face on Monday and the manager isn't the only person who knew. Swap Slack for Telegram, Discord, or Google Chat at install.

  5. 05
    Documents Come Back Automatically

    The new hire uploads through the document form, and the Document Collection workflow matches the submission to their record by email and marks documents received. No forwarding attachments, no renaming files, no one asking whether the ID copy ever arrived.

  6. 06
    Progress Is Always Visible

    The Onboarding Tracker sheet shows exactly where every hire stands: setup, awaiting-documents, ready. One view answers the only question HR actually gets asked about onboarding: who still needs chasing?

FAQ

Questions about New Employee Onboarding.

What happens after HR submits the intake form?
Onboarding tasks are created from your checklist, a warm welcome email goes to the hire, the team is notified in Slack, and a separate document upload form is sent so paperwork returns without anyone chasing it.
What do I need to connect?
Trello, Gmail and Slack. Trello holds the generated task list, Gmail sends the welcome and document request, and Slack announces the hire. Notion, Asana and Monday.com are listed alternatives to Trello at install.
Can I define our own onboarding checklist?
Yes. onboarding_checklist and training_activities are configuration values, so the tasks created are yours rather than a generic template. Change them and every future hire gets the updated list.
How do documents come back?
Through a dedicated New Hire Document Upload form whose URL is set at install and included in the welcome email. Submissions land on its response sheet, so HR sees what has arrived and what is still outstanding.
Is progress visible without asking?
Yes. Tasks live in Trello and each hire has a row from the intake form, so onboarding status is something you look at rather than something you request in a meeting.
